The U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ission held its inaugural Innovation Advisory Committee meeting, bringing together participants to discuss the regulatory landscape spanning cryptocurrency, artificial intelligence, and prediction markets. The session encompassed opening remarks alongside retrospectives on how cryptocurrency evolved from regulatory uncertainty toward established frameworks, accounts from industry practitioners describing on-the-ground experiences, and recaps of regulator initiatives to date.
The committee's scope extended to emerging challenges facing the sector, including questions around market structure design and cybersecurity safeguards. The breadth of topics signals the CFTC's intention to address multiple dimensions of digital assets and related technologies in a single advisory forum.
What remains unclear is the composition of the committee, specific policy proposals or recommendations that may emerge from the discussion, or whether follow-up meetings are scheduled. The agenda outline provided public visibility into the session's thematic coverage but not the substantive positions or outcomes.
